Step-by-Step Solution: The Conversion Factor

The key to converting between centimeters and inches lies in understanding the conversion factor. One inch is approximately equal to 2.54 centimeters. This means that for every inch, there are 2.54 centimeters. This is the crucial ratio we will use for our conversion.

Method 1: Using the Conversion Factor Directly

This method involves a simple calculation using the conversion factor.

1. Identify the given value: We have 67 cm.
2. Determine the conversion factor: 1 inch = 2.54 cm
3. Set up the conversion equation: We want to convert centimeters to inches, so we need to divide the number of centimeters by the conversion factor. This ensures that the 'cm' units cancel out, leaving us with inches. The equation looks like this:

`Inches = Centimeters / (cm/inch)` or `Inches = Centimeters / 2.54`

4. Substitute and solve: Substitute 67 cm into the equation:

`Inches = 67 cm / 2.54 cm/inch`

5. Calculate: Performing the calculation, we get:

`Inches ≈ 26.37795 inches`

6. Round to appropriate precision: Depending on the context, you may need to round the answer. For example, for measuring curtains, rounding to one decimal place (26.4 inches) would likely suffice.

FAQs

1. Why is the conversion factor 2.54? This is a defined conversion, based on the international standard for the inch. It's a fixed ratio, not an approximation resulting from measurement.

2. How do I convert inches back to centimeters? To convert inches to centimeters, simply multiply the number of inches by 2.54. For example, 26.4 inches 2.54 cm/inch ≈ 67 cm.

3. What if I need to convert other metric units to imperial units (e.g., meters to feet)? You'll need to find the appropriate conversion factor for those units and follow a similar process. Remember to ensure the units cancel out correctly in your equation.

4. Are there online converters available? Yes, numerous online converters are readily available. These can be helpful for quick conversions, but understanding the underlying principles is essential for problem-solving.

5. What level of precision should I use when rounding? The level of precision depends on the context. For precise engineering or scientific work, higher precision is necessary. For everyday tasks like measuring curtains, rounding to one decimal place is often sufficient. Always consider the acceptable margin of error for your specific application.
